Mesa, Arizona, is a city that embraces its cultural diversity and celebrates the arts with enthusiasm. The Mesa Arts Center, a state-of-the-art facility, serves as the focal point for the city's cultural activities, offering a wide range of performances, exhibitions, and educational programs. This award-winning center is home to four theaters, five art galleries, and 14 art studios, making it a vibrant hub for creativity and expression.

Mesa is home to several major sports facilities, including the Sloan Park, which serves as the spring training home of the Chicago Cubs. The park's state-of-the-art amenities and beautiful setting make it a popular destination for baseball fans and sports enthusiasts.

Mesa, Arizona, has experienced significant economic growth and development in recent years, driven by its strategic location, diverse economy, and commitment to innovation. The city is home to a thriving business community, with key industries including aerospace, healthcare, education, and technology.

One of the most popular events in Mesa is the annual Arizona Renaissance Festival, a lively celebration of medieval culture that features jousting, music, and theatrical performances. The festival attracts thousands of visitors each year, offering a unique and immersive experience for attendees of all ages.
Mesa's rich cultural heritage is also reflected in its historical sites and museums, which offer insights into the city's past and the contributions of its diverse communities. The Arizona Museum of Natural History, for instance, provides a fascinating look at the region's prehistoric and Native American heritage, while the Mesa Historical Museum explores the city's agricultural roots and the impact of the railroad on its development.

The aerospace sector, in particular, has been a major driver of Mesa's economic success, with companies such as Boeing and MD Helicopters establishing significant operations in the area. The presence of these industry leaders has helped attract a skilled workforce and foster a culture of innovation and collaboration.
